Dean Raab

Senior Attorney, Department of Defense Standards of Conduct Office

Mr. F. Dean Raab is a senior attorney in the Standards of Conduct Office, Office of the General Counsel, Department of Defense. Mr. Raab provides ethics advice to members of the Office of the Secretary of Defense, and assists the Alternate Designated Agency Ethics Official with the execution of the DoD ethics program. He previously served as an ethics attorney in the Army General Counsel’s office. Mr. Raab served on active duty in the Army JAG Corps for 27 years, retiring in 2018. His assignments included Executive Officer to the General Counsel of the Army; Staff Judge Advocate, US Army Medical Command; Legal Advisor, Office of Security Cooperation-Iraq; Deputy Staff Judge Advocate, US Army Pacific; Staff Judge Advocate, National Training Center and Fort Irwin; and Assistant Executive Officer, Office of The Judge Advocate General. Mr. Raab is a graduate of the US Army Command and General Staff College, and completed a US Army War College Fellowship in the Civil Division, US Department of Justice. He received a B.A. in Political Science from the University of Michigan, and a J.D. from The Dickinson School of Law, Pennsylvania State University. Mr. Raab is admitted to practice law in the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ania.
